    La Michoacana Meat Market is a Hispanic-themed chain of Hispanic specialty stores and grocery stores in the United States, headquartered in Spring Branch, [1] Houston, Texas. [2] Rafael Ortega heads the chain, which has about 135 stores. [3] The stores are located in an area stretching from the Rio Grande Valley to Oklahoma City, Oklahoma.

    Westphalia is a small unincorporated community in Falls County, Texas, United States, located 35 mi (56 km) south of Waco on State Highway 320. Westphalia has a strong German and Catholic background. The Church of the Visitation was, until recently, the largest wooden church west of the Mississippi River.
